You Are:

UST is looking for a talented and Business System Analyst for one of the leading healthcare providers in the United States. This is an excellent opportunity to work in a growing environment. The ideal candidate must have strong skills in Pega development and Testing at the same time be able to put their creative hat in a problem-solving environment.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to collaborate effectively with domain experts and IT leadership team is key to be successful in this role.

The Opportunity:


Manages integrated functionality, usability, reliability, performance and support requirements of a system.
Creates feature test strategies and environment needs.
Provides the link between the technical and business views of the system by ensuring that the technical solutions being developed will satisfy the needs of the business.
Applies and mentors use of tools to define requirements.
Anticipates and identifies opportunities for improvement.
Ensures high level designs including architecture requirements are accurately documented and map to approved requirements.
Assists in developing training documentation and proactive identification of additional documentation needs.
Coordination with Customer SMEs, IT Managers, Offshore and the onsite team for Business requirement gathering/Use cases and document.
Document high level business/ process flows
Coordinate with the Testing team and ensure the application is defect free, before the code move to production.
Coordination with other teams for application integration
Coordinate for the smooth system integration testing and user acceptance testing.
Perform process inventory and prioritization following the BPM methodology.
Execute the Process Discovery phases, address the goals and create the deliverables following the Pega.
Discover, define, analyze, improve, and model a process in Pega process flows.
Identify the business case, requirements and key opportunities.
Define the business level of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) and Service Level Agreements (SLAs).
Understand the functionalities and capabilities of Pega Process flows for delivering executable BPM processes.

What you need:


Requires a basic understanding of testing/product quality processes, tools and methods and an understanding or organizational impacts and trade-offs of quality processes.
Understanding of Native development and Java are preferred
Knowledge of Rational Tools, project management experience and training in facilitation preferred.
Knowledge of a variety of technologies and/or the ability to understand technology dependencies and manage technology integration required
Experience working within health insurance industry.
Experience/exposure in JIRA & Confluence
Experience/exposure in Agile & SAFe
Experience/exposure with APIs
Experience/exposure in Postman
Zeplin Experience is a plus
The ability to visualize and create high-level models that can be used in future analysis to extend and mature the business architecture
Team player able to work effectively at all levels of an organization with the ability to influence others to move toward consensus
Strong situational analysis and decision-making abilities
